Ann Johnson Stultz, of Rock Spring, passed away on Tuesday, June 20, 2017, at the age of 84.

She was born in LaFayette (Linwood) on July 5, 1932, to the late Clyde Robert Johnson and Edith Brock Johnson. A graduate of LaFayette High School, Ann followed her heart and aspiration for helping others by pursing a nursing degree from Georgia Baptist College of Nursing. Her nursing career spanned a variety of medical areas before a 31-year stint as director of nursing with Tri-County-Hutcheson Medical Center. Her passion for nursing was equaled for her love of cats, as she was a very generous and monumental financial supporter of animal shelters. She was an avid history buff, and enjoyed local Walker County history.

Along with her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band, Raymond L. Stultz.

Survivors include special friend/caregiver, Tammy Parshall, who Ann considered as a daughter; her son, Robert “Robby” (Andrea) Stultz of Fort Oglethorpe; and grandchildren, Robert Brandon (Christa) Stultz and Patrick Chase Stultz.
